Business Planning for New Dentists
- Defining the corporate entity structure, which affects your current and future tax planning
- Establishing an efficient debt structure to tackle your new debt strategically
- Implementing a tax-effective payroll structure, including spousal salary from the practice, when applicable
- Production analysis & goal setting for the practice
- Review of business loan(s) and appropriate fees
- Tax allocation for the acquisition of a new office
- Benefits of establishing a new corporation versus “taking over” an existing one
- Fee analysis, including discussion of insurance acceptance and profitability
- Practice insurance needs and costs
- Examination of direct and fixed expenses
- Practice break-even analysis
- Efficient pension plan design to maximize savings and minimize taxes
- Tax planning strategies for your business, including what to deduct and when
- Planning for practice expansion, transition, or possible associate
Personal Financial Planning for New Dentists
- Personal budgeting for the household and financial goal setting
- Debt management and tax-efficient debt reduction planning
- Personal income tax planning
- Detailed review of insurance coverage
- Education savings plan for dependent children and review of the most advantageous investment choices
- Reviewing estate plans to ensure bases are covered for you, your spouse, and your beneficiaries
- Analysis of other critical issues that are important to you
- Investment analysis and asset allocations are designed to help you reach your goals within your risk tolerance
